The topic of menopause and sexuality receives little public attention and is certainly not addressed in porn. With “Olivia”, festival regular Inka Winter has not only realized a personal passion project but also created a bold, taboo-breaking film. Bestselling author Olivia is going through the menopause due to her age, struggling with the physical changes – and on top of that, a case of writer’s block. But through her encounter with Roman and the support of her friends, she manages to rediscover her sexuality and her body, with all its – initially unwanted – changes, and finally begins to enjoy them again. A feminist statement that shows women (and men) over the age of 50, in a refreshingly calm and charming way, as they face the endlessly frustrating battle with their hormone balance.
